Abstract
Activity-based probes based on polyubiquitin chains are powerful tools for studying ubiquitin-conjugating pathways and the substrate specificity of deubiquitinase (DUB) enzymes. These probes can be synthesized through a genetically encoded unnatural amino acid (UAA), Nε-L-thiaprolyl-L-lysine (ThzK). This chapter details the chemical synthesis of ThzK and preparation of diUb probes, leveraging ThzK to enable the production of site-specifically installed isopeptide bonds. The resulting probes facilitate mechanistic studies of ubiquitination and deubiquitination specificity and have applications in understanding diseases associated with ubiquitination dysfunction.
